RESULTS ARE IN! From March 2021 to July 2021 483 water samples were collected by volunteers in the Brecks. The sampling kits test for nitrate and phosphate in the water. Project 1.5 Update – September 2021 On Monday 27th September, the first day of restoring ghost pingo ponds on Thompson Common began The work is being led by Norfolk Wildlife Trust on their newly acquired Watering Farm land, and is supported by Carl Sayer and colleagues from UCL, as well as local Geologist Tim Holt-Wilson, Archaeologist David Robinson and many other skilled […] | More
